Sarah is a Research & Evaluation Consultant with an MSc in Health & Social Care Management & Policy. She has a strong background in working with young people from marginalised backgrounds. Sarah’s approach is anchored in co-produced methodologies, ensuring meaningful stakeholder involvement in evaluation processes. Her professional journey also includes significant work in trauma-informed, gender-sensitive and culturally aware research and evaluation.
Until 2022, Sarah worked at Fulfilling Lives Lambeth, Southwark and Lewisham where she focused on building relationships with community groups, co-producing developmental evaluative research on their needs and barriers faced, and (re)developing the services and peer-led projects offered accordingly.
Recently Sarah worked with young people in communities funded by Empowering Local, conducting research aimed at strengthening their approach to place-based funding for young people’s support services. She also led a Youth Futures Foundation research project to understand how services can better talk to young people about their identities, and use this demographic data to deliver more equitable services.
